Kinds of Daycares:
There are various kinds of daycares available, each catering to different needs and preferences. Some traditional types of daycares feature:
- In-home Daycares: they're usually run by a person or family in their own personal residence. They feature a far more intimate environment with a diminished child-to-caregiver proportion.
- Childcare Centers: they are larger services that focus on a bigger range kids. They might offer even more structured programs and tasks.
- Preschools: they are much like childcare centers but focus more on very early education and college readiness.
- Montessori Schools: These schools follow the Montessori approach to knowledge, which emphasizes self-reliance, self-directed learning, and hands-on tasks.
Services Granted:
Daycares provide a variety of services to fulfill the requirements of working moms and dads and offer a nurturing environment for children. Some typically common services offered by daycares consist of:
- Full-day care: numerous daycares provide full-day maintain working moms and dads, supplying care from early morning until night.
- Part-time treatment: Some daycares offer part-time treatment options for parents just who just need maintain a couple of days a week or several hours every day.
- Early knowledge: numerous daycares provide very early education programs that give attention to college readiness and intellectual development.
- Healthy meals: Some daycares supply nourishing dishes and snacks for kids each day.
Services:
The facilities at a daycare play a crucial role in offering a secure and stimulating environment for children. Some things to consider whenever evaluating daycare facilities include:
- Cleanliness: The daycare should really be neat and well-maintained so that the health and safety of this kids.
- Safety measures: The daycare need safety precautions set up, like childproofing, secure entrances, and crisis treatments.
- Enjoy areas: The daycare need age-appropriate play areas and gear for children to engage in physical activity and play.
- Learning materials: The daycare need to have a variety of learning materials, books, and toys to advertise cognitive development and creativity.
Prices:
The cost of daycare can vary with regards to the style of daycare, area, and services supplied. Some aspects that may influence the cost of daycare consist of:

- Variety of daycare: In-home daycares might be inexpensive than childcare centers or preschools.
- Place: Daycares in towns or high-cost-of-living areas may have higher costs.
- Providers supplied: Daycares offering additional services, eg early knowledge programs or dishes, may have higher costs.
- Subsidies: Some people might be qualified to receive subsidies or economic assist with assist protect the price of daycare.
